What are the must-see attractions in Dominica?
Dominica, an island renowned for its unspoiled natural beauty, offers numerous must-see attractions. The Boiling Lake, the second-largest hot lake in the world, is a hallmark site in the UNESCO-listed Morne Trois Pitons National Park. This park also features the stunning Trafalgar Falls, where nature’s power is on full display. For diving enthusiasts, the Champagne Reef Marine Reserve provides a unique experience with naturally occurring bubbles that make you feel like you're swimming in a giant glass of bubbly. Lastly, don't miss the Northern Forest Reserve, a perfect place for hiking and home to intriguing flora and fauna, including the Sisserou Parrot, Dominica’s national bird. What is the best time to visit Dominica?
The best time to visit Dominica is between December and April, during the dry season. These months offer the most favorable climate with pleasant temperatures and minimal rainfall, allowing visitors to fully enjoy outdoor activities and explore the natural scenery. From July to October, Dominica experiences hurricane season, bringing more frequent storms and significant rainfall, making it a less ideal time to travel. However, those seeking a quieter experience might consider visiting in May or June, right before the peak hurricane season, when the island sees fewer tourists. With an average annual temperature of about 26°C, Dominica remains a welcoming destination year-round for nature lovers and adventure seekers.
What activities can one do in Dominica?
Dominica offers a plethora of activities catering to every taste, making it an ideal destination for nature and adventure enthusiasts. Hiking fans shouldn’t miss the Waitukubuli National Trail, the longest trekking path in the Caribbean, offering breathtaking views and encounters with the island’s unique flora and fauna. For those looking to relax, Dominica’s numerous beaches, like Mero Beach, are perfect for sunny leisure days. Diving enthusiasts can explore the colorful coral reefs and diverse marine life at Soufrière Bay. For a cultural experience, participate in a local craft workshop or explore the rich historical heritage of Roseau, the capital. Lastly, don’t miss the opportunity to visit Emerald Pool, where you can swim in a natural pool surrounded by lush vegetation.

What language is spoken in Dominica?
The official language of Dominica is English, which makes communication easier for French-speaking travelers with basic English knowledge. However, the local language, Dominican Creole, also known as patois or kwéyòl, is widely spoken by the local population. This Creole, derived from French, may be understandable to those familiar with Caribbean Creole. What currency is used in Dominica?
The official currency of Dominica is the Eastern Caribbean Dollar (XCD). It is advisable to arrive with some euros that you can exchange locally. Credit cards are generally accepted in major hotels and restaurants, but it is wise to have cash on hand for rural areas. Are there any culinary specialties to discover in Dominica?
Dominica is a true culinary paradise where Creole flavors meet freshness and diversity. Must-try specialties include callaloo, a green vegetable soup, and the typical local fish stew with exotic spices. Tropical fruits like mangoes and papayas are abundant and delicious. Is it easy to get around on the island of Dominica?
Getting around in Dominica is relatively easy thanks to a decent network of roads and public transport. Renting a car is a popular option for travelers wanting to explore the island freely. Taxis and minibuses are also available for shorter trips.
